The word "gruelling" in the first paragraph probably means [br] Which of the following statements is NOT true of ECT?
选项
A、It came into being long time ago.
B、It may cause the self-protection of the brain.
C、It is employed as treatment of a certain disease.
D、It was used to control those who lost their will.
答案
D
解析
本题是细节题。第五段末句提到...it nevertheless provokes the damage-limitation response,[B]符合文意。末段首句指出ECT, invented in a more brutal age,[A]符合文意。末句中的it now serves to give will back to those who have lost it,[C]正是对这部分内容的解释,符合文意。末段首句指出:在病人不愿意的情况下,过去使用ECT来控制难以驾驭的病人,[D]是对该部分against their will的曲解,故为答案。
